uniapp怎么在页面原生js文件
时间: 2023-09-23 16:03:45 浏览: 69
Uniapp是一个基于Vue.js框架的跨平台开发框架,可以同时开发小程序、H5、App等多个平台。如果要在页面中使用原生JS文件,需要在项目中先引入JS文件,并将其注册为Vue组件。
具体步骤如下:
1. 在项目中创建一个JS文件,比如叫做myNative.js,编写JS代码。
2. 在需要使用该JS文件的Vue组件中,使用import语句引入该JS文件。
3. 在Vue组件中的methods中,定义一个函数来调用myNative.js中的函数。
4. 在Vue组件的mounted生命周期中,调用该函数即可。
示例代码如下:
```
<template>
<div>
<button @click="callNative">调用原生方法</button>
</div>
</template>
<script>
import myNative from './myNative.js'
export default {
name: 'myPage',
methods: {
callNative() {
myNative.myFunction()
}
},
mounted() {
this.callNative()
}
}
</script>
```
在以上示例中,我们通过import语句引入了myNative.js文件,并在methods中定义了一个callNative函数来调用myNative.js中的myFunction函数。在mounted生命周期中,我们调用了callNative函数来触发原生方法的调用。